Courseware Developer And Architect
QuickLearn is best known for its diverse training in all things BizTalk Server. The first course that I developer for QuickLearn and the one for which I acquired international acclaim is the Developer Deep Dive. I was the architect of this course working with Microsoft employees and BizTalk constultants to create what is without a doubt the best and most attended BizTalk course ever. This course originally created for BizTalk 2004 has been updated for each subsequent version of BizTalk Server through BizTalk 2016.I was also instrumental in designing and writing the beginning level developer course and beginning and advanced courses for BizTalk Administrators as well as co-authoring various expert-series courses in specific BizTalk disciplines, Business Rules Engine (BRE), Business Activity Monitoring (BAM), Electronic Data Interchange (EDI), and the use of the ESB (Enterprise Service Bus) toolkit.
